Citizenship, with financial investment. Presently, as of March 15, 2022, the quantity of investment is $800,000 (in Targeted Work Locations and Country Areas) and $1,050,000 elsewhere (non-TEA zones). Congress has accepted these amounts for the next 5 years starting March 15, 2022.


To certify for the EB-5 Visa, Capitalists must produce 10 permanent U.S. jobs within 2 years from the day of their complete financial investment. EB5 Investment Immigration. This EB-5 Visa Requirement guarantees that investments contribute directly to the U.S. task market. This uses whether the jobs are produced directly by the business or indirectly under sponsorship of a marked EB-5 Regional Center like EB5 United

These work are determined with models that utilize inputs such as development prices (e.g., building and construction and devices costs) or annual incomes created by continuous operations. In contrast, under the standalone, or direct, EB-5 Program, only straight, full-time W-2 worker placements within the company might be counted. A crucial threat of relying exclusively on direct employees is that team decreases due to market problems can result in not enough full time settings, potentially leading to USCIS denial of the capitalist's petition if the work creation requirement is not satisfied.

This measure has been a remarkable success. Today, 95% of all EB-5 capital is raised and spent by Regional Centers. Considering that the 2008 financial situation, access to funding has been tightened and municipal budget plans remain to encounter substantial deficiencies. In several regions, EB-5 financial investments have actually filled the funding void, providing a new, important resource of resources for neighborhood financial growth jobs that revitalize areas, develop and support jobs, infrastructure, and services.

Even more than 25 countries, consisting of Australia and the United Kingdom, usage comparable programs to bring in foreign financial investments. The American program is much more rigorous than lots of others, calling for significant danger for financiers in terms of both their economic investment and immigration status.
